Abstract

The invention discloses a semi-no-tillage machine ditching and broadcast sowing cultivation method of wheat following rice. The semi-no-tillage machine ditching and broadcast sowing cultivation method comprises the following steps: selecting crop rotation and varieties; determining a sowing amount and applying fertilizers; applying base fertilizers and applying 5kg-7kg of urea into rice straw full-amount mulching paddy field base fertilizers to catalyze the rotting of straws; uniformly sowing seeds; managing the wheat following rice and harvesting when the wheat is 100% ripe; drying, storing and selling. According to the semi-no-tillage machine ditching and broadcast sowing cultivation method, the nutrition of soil is increased in the rice straw full-amount mulching paddy field base fertilizers, so that the granule structure of the soil is improved and the nitrogen fixation effect of the soil is increased; before the wheat following rice sprouts after being fertilized and sowed, a rotary cultivator is selected according to farmable soil moisture content and is used for carrying out shallow rotary semi-no-tillage and ditching; ditches are cleaned after the seeds are sowed and seedlings sprout; the water and soil loss is reduced; a cultivation land can be protected, the soil moisture content is improved and the temperature is increased, the direct surface runoff of rainstorm weathers is increased and the water-logging is reduced.

Background technology
Wheat or barley is planted after the results paddy rice of rice field.There is Wheat After Getting Rice in southern china and the north, mainly be distributed in the Yangtze river basin, based on wheat-rice rotation to the north of the Yangtze river basin, on the south the Yangtze river basin except wheat-rice rotation, province and the Shanghai City such as Jiangsu, Zhejiang, Jiangxi, Hunan, Fujian, also have early rice late rice wheat (or barley) three crops per annual.Since 20 century 70s, varieties in Huang-Huai-Hai Plain some local implementation changing the drought field to the paddy one and Dry seeded rice, expand rice cultivation area, thus developed wheat-rice rotation plantation system.Plantation Wheat After Getting Rice area wheat commodity rate is higher, and has larger yield potential.This cropping system plays an important role to raising total output of grain.
The most of area of southern china, Wheat After Getting Rice is emerged incomplete, irregular, and cultivation management is extensive, and fertilising is not enough, and late growth stage is rainy, wet injury weight, native haftplatte knot, and disease, worm, crop smothering are all more general; Riverine lakeside area on the south 31 ° of N, the popular frequency of head blight is high.North Wheat After Getting Rice because of crops for rotation slow, sowing evening, fringe is few, fringe is little, again meets Drought in later stage more, often yields poorly and unstable.

Embodiment 1
A kind of Wheat after rice half no-tillage machine trench digging broadcasts sowing cultivation method, comprises the following steps:
1, crop succession and wheat breed are selected
Precocious rice stubble field non-ploughing, namely allowing a batch rice field to early October by the end of September, selects plantation Semi-winter wheat as poplar wheat 158 or all wheats 22; In, late sowing japonica rice stubble in evening, mid or late October in early November, late sowing round-grained rice rice stubble field non-ploughing in evening, select plantation Late frost damage; Mid or late November allows a batch rice field, sows precocious spring wheat.
2, seeding quantity, total fertilization amount
Early October allows a batch rice field, sowing Semi-winter wheat field, mu seeding quantity 12-13kg, per mu input fertilizer total amount (containing pure amount of nutrients) 45kg: wherein purity nitrogen 18kg, phosphorus pentoxide 6kg, potassium oxide 21kg; A batch rice field is allowed, sowing spring wheat field, mu seeding quantity 16-20kg, per mu input fertilizer total amount (containing pure amount of nutrients) 40kg: wherein purity nitrogen 16kg, phosphorus pentoxide 5kg, potassium oxide 19kg at the beginning of mid or late October to 11 month; Mid or late November allows a batch rice field, sows precocious spring wheat, mu seeding quantity 20-25kg, per mu input fertilizer total amount (containing pure amount of nutrients) 35kg: wherein purity nitrogen 14kg, phosphorus pentoxide 5kg, potassium oxide 16kg.
3, base manure is used
Nitrogen in wheat basal fertilizer, potash fertilizer by total amount 65%, phosphate fertilizer is by 100% of total amount, namely mu 45% Nitrogen, Phosphorus and Potassium 35-40kg adds 0.5kg particle zinc fertilizer, after previous crops allows stubble, before sowing, disposable fertilizer distributor holostrome applies, urea 5-7kg to be affixed by, to urge rotten straw in paddy stalk total crop return field base manure.
4, evenly sow
4.1 bask seeds
2-3 days before wheat cultivation, by sowing wheat seed at earth on the ground or be covered with on plastic sheeting for farm use place and shine 1-2 days, one is break wheat resting stage, and two is kill the surface of the seed germ, improves germination regularity and germination rate.
4.2 seed dressing
Sowing before with every 100kg seed 25% Prochloraz 80-100ml add 35% fourth sulphur g Budweiser 100g to water 5kg evenly dress seed pile vexed 3-5 hour, carry out dressing wheat seed.
4.3 " three fit " sowing
According to suitable field soil moisture content, select suitable seeding quantity, late September is to early October, use Semi-winter wheat seed, at soil moisture content suitable (), mu about seeding quantity 11-13kg, when soil overdrying or mistake wet, mu seeding quantity is increased to 15kg under soil moisture 80-85% together.Mid or late October is to early November, with Late frost damage, when soil moisture content is suitable for, mu seeding quantity 16-18kg, soil overdrying or when crossing wet seeding quantity be increased to 20kg, mid-November and after, use precocious Late frost damage, the mu seeding quantity 21-23kg when soil moisture content is suitable for, when overdrying or mistake wet, seeding quantity is increased to 25kg.Type of seeding is: in " three fit " situation, carry out uniform broadcasting or drilling with sower before the later half no-tillage trench digging of fertilising.
4.4 half no-tillage machine trench diggings
Before rice stubble field non-ploughing wheat fertilizing is after planting emerged, rotary tillage machine is selected to carry out shallowly revolving half no-tillage, trench digging according to soil moisture content should be ploughed.Method hangs three-piece with 488 large-scale rotovators: preposition group revolves cutter, middle extension ditching knife (wide 25cm, dark 25cm), rear extension drops down flat board or suppression plate carries out disposable operation, require the dark 40cm of gutter, waist ditch depth 30cm, furrow ditch depth 20cm, furrow face width should at 1.2-1.5m.
4.5 ditch cleaning
Artificial ditch cleaning to be used in time before after planting emerging, more logical " three ditches " i.e. waist ditch, furrow ditch and gutter, accomplish that " three ditches " communicates.
4.6 close down weeding
Close down weeding in time after reason ditch ditch cleaning, mu paraquat 200ml add 75% isoproturon 120g to water 45kg dragging tube type sprayer even spraying in furrow face, furrow ditch and ridge, one can kill size green grass and rice stub, and two can close weeding.
5, the management of Wheat after rice
5.1 chase after seed manure
Topdressed before winter and will carry out at halcyon days, mu imposes " cured fertilizer " urea 10kg, potassium chloride 5kg.
5.2 weeding
The plot that sealing effect is bad or location, temperature more than 15 degree before the winter, grass resemble 2 leaf phases want in time with wheat pole 20g or wheat happiness 80ml to water spray, be less than 1.5 leaves prevent and kill off when period of seedling establishment temperature goes back up to more than 15 degree after the spring if grass resemble leaf age.
5.3 impose striking root fertilizer
After spring, simultaneously, mu imposes striking root fertilizer urea 5kg to striking root herbicide, promotes to tiller.
5.4 heavy dressing jointing are fertile
When the long timing of wheat base portion first segment, when second section grows to 1cm, mu imposes 45%N-K composite fertilizer 10-15kg or urea 15kg, potassium chloride 10kg, spreads fertilizer over the fields without holostrome during dew on ground moistening, blade face.
5.5 wheats one spray four to be prevented
Attention control banded sclerotial blight and powdery mildew during wheat envelope row, agricultural measures: ditch cleaning reason water row stain, Potassium.Wheat is eared after neat fringe and is carried out preventing and treating head blight and small brown rice planthopper before 10% flowering, and mu is with 75% oxime bacterium. and Tebuconazole 30ml adds 20% triazolone 80g and adds 2% Avermectin 100ml and add 25% pymetrozine and add 0.2% micro-fertilizer and carry out foliar spray to water 45kg in time morning and evening.
5.6 wheat ripe and harvested
When wheat 100% is ripe, to gather in time time fine according to following 3-5 days weather, dry storing and sell.
